My friends know that I listen to Country music on Sunday evenings.

We grew up listening to country music at home. Dad had/still has old country music records that he used to spin on the old fashioned turntable connected to an amplifier and speakers. So Jim Reeves, Don Williams, George Jones, Dolly Parton, etc were a staple at home in the 90s.

I think Don Williams and Jim Reeves had more fans in Africa/Nigeria than in their native America.

Along the line, I started listening to Country music splash on my local radio station and that pretty much sealed Country music as my weekly Sunday night playlist. I love the old Nashville Tennessee sound and listen more to the old generation country artistes than the new school country singers.

Country music is so cool, the songs are basically stories: love stories, family life stories, funny stories, stories of faith, hope and despair.
